Social media and email hacking reports jumped last year, says Action Fraud. A total of 35,434 reports were made to the fraud and cyber crime reporting service in 2024, compared with 22,530 in 2023.

Social media and email hacking reports surged 57 per cent last year, Action Fraud revealed today. That's a huge rise but it's likely to be even greater, as social media hacking is under-reported.
